- 解决方案:glide FileNotFoundException("FileDescriptor is null for: " + uri)
问题原因是指定的资源文件无效或无法找到,可能由路径错误、文件删除等原因引起。解决方案包括确保传递的Uri参数有效、文件存在、捕获异常等。具体例子涉及正确配置Glide的图片加载路径,传入正确的URI和指定加载目标。
2025-03-03 23:30:29 - 最佳方案处理react-native IllegalStateException("Invalid image event: " + Integer.toString(eventType))
在React Native中出现IllegalStateException错误的原因是无法识别或处理特定类型的图像事件,解决方法包括正确传递事件参数、正确处理事件类型、按照库文档设置参数、检查自定义组件逻辑。示例代码展示了正确处理Image组件加载事件的方法。解决IllegalStateException错误方法包括正确匹配和处理事件类型、使用try-catch块捕获异常。示例代码展示了使用fetch加载图片并处理异常的方式。通过正确处理事件类型和异常,可避免IllegalStateException错误的发生。
2025-03-03 15:30:21 - urllib3出现ValueError(f"body_pos must be of type integer, instead it was {type(body_pos)}.")的解决方案
urllib3中出现ValueError的问题原因和解决方案。问题通常由于传入的body_pos参数不是整数类型导致。解决方法包括确认参数是整数、值大于等于0,阅读官方文档等。具体例子展示了如何处理异常情况。
2025-03-03 11:11:02 - 关于glide的IllegalArgumentException("Height must be > 0")
IllegalArgumentException("Height must be > 0")异常通常在使用Glide加载图片时出现,原因是传入的高度值小于等于0。要避免异常,需要确保传入的高度值是大于0的整数。解决方法包括确保传入合法高度值、动态计算高度时进行合法性检查、手动设置合法高度值等。正确使用Glide加载图片可避免异常。
2025-03-02 19:37:01 - glide有IllegalArgumentException("Width must be > 0")报错是怎么回事
IllegalArgumentException("Width must be > 0")异常的原因是在使用Glide加载图片时传入的宽度参数是无效值,解决方法包括确保传入宽度大于0、动态获取正确宽度值、处理异常逻辑等。正确使用Glide可避免异常,示例代码展示了如何传入合法宽度参数避免问题。
2025-03-01 02:54:04 - urllib3出现ReadTimeoutError(self, url, f"Read timed out. (read timeout={read_timeout})")的解决方案
urllib3出现ReadTimeoutError的原因是在与服务器建立连接后,接收数据的过程中超过了设定的读取超时时间,解决方案包括增加读取超时时间、优化网络连接、检查服务器响应时间、使用重试机制和捕获异常并处理。通过捕获ReadTimeoutError异常并根据具体情况处理可以有效解决问题。具体例子中展示了如何使用urllib3发送HTTP请求并处理ReadTimeoutError异常。
2025-02-28 18:11:38 - 报错IllegalStateException("Can't add already added bitmap: "+ bitmap+ " ["+ bitmap.getWidth()的解决
讨论了 Glide 中出现 IllegalStateException("Can't add already added bitmap") 异常的原因和解决方案,主要是由于重复添加已缓存的 Bitmap 对象所引起。强调了避免重复加载相同图片和在加载图片前检查是否已存在相同图片的重要性,提供了相应的示例代码。
2025-02-27 23:12:35 - 报错Exception("The `add_srs_entry` utility only works with spatial backends.")的解决
在Django中使用空间后端和GIS功能时可能出现Exception异常,需要配置支持空间功能的数据库后端和正确导入空间模型函数来解决。示例中展示了如何正确配置和使用空间数据功能。
2025-02-27 12:00:25 - 报错IllegalViewOperationException("Invalid layout animation : " + data)的解决
在React Native项目中,出现IllegalViewOperationException异常的原因是布局动画设置错误,需要检查动画参数的正确性和有效性。解决方法包括检查布局动画设置、使用正确的动画函数、检查动画参数和更新React Native版本。示例代码展示了正确使用布局动画的方法。该问题通常是因为传递无效参数引起的,要避免异常需确保传递正确的配置对象给布局动画。
2025-02-27 11:13:38 - 提示RuntimeException("Tried to increment non-existent cookie")的解决方案
在React Native中出现RuntimeException("Tried to increment non-existent cookie")的原因是尝试操作不存在的cookie,解决方法包括确保cookie存在、创建新cookie对象、做好错误处理。具体例子包括确认第三方库版本、清除cookie缓存、检查代码中对cookie的操作。示例代码展示了正确增加cookie并开启WebView的JavaScript支持。
2025-02-25 11:43:00